Texas Border Receives Migrants From More than 60 Countries as Smugglers Use Drones to Monitor Agents
McAllen, Texas, United States. The U.S. southern border in the Rio Grande Valley sector has become a route used by migrants from more than 60 countries, according to data provided by the Border Patrol during a tour with international journalists participating in the U.S. Immigration Coverage Program, organized by InquireFirst and the U.S. State Department.
